GE Aerospace GE reported fourth-quarter 2025 results, wherein both revenues and earnings surpassed the Zacks Consensus Estimate.
It is worth noting that in April 2024, GE Aerospace emerged as a separate public company, following the spin-off of GE Vernova Inc. GEV from General Electric.
Inside GE’s Headlines
The company’s fourth-quarter adjusted earnings were $1.57 per share, which beat the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$1.44. The bottom line surged 19% year over year.
Total revenues were $12.7 billion, indicating a year-over-year increase of 18%. Total orders soared 74% on a year-over-year basis to $27 billion.
Adjusted revenues were $11.87 billion, marking a year-over-year increase of 20%. The metric beat the consensus estimate of $11.26 billion.
For 2025, GE Aerospace reported adjusted revenues of $42.3 billion, reflecting an increase of 21% year over year. The company’s adjusted earnings were $6.37 per share, up 38% year-over-year.
GE’s Segmental Discussion in Q4
Revenues from the company’s Commercial Engines & Services business jumped 24% year over year to $9.47 billion. The Zacks Consensus Estimate for the business’ revenues was pegged at $9.09 billion. The results were driven by higher shop visit work scope, increased revenues from spare parts and equipment and favorable pricing. Total orders in the segment rose 76% year over year to $22.8 billion.
The Defense & Propulsion Technologies segment’s revenues totaled $2.84 billion, up 13% year over year. The Zacks Consensus Estimate for the segment’s revenues was pegged at $2.73 billion. Results benefited from the strong momentum in the Defense & Systems and Propulsion & Additive Technologies businesses. Total orders in the segment increased 61% year over year to $4.57 billion.

GE’s Margin Profile
GE Aerospace’s cost of sales (comprising costs of equipment and services sold) surged 23.7% year over year at $8.36 billion. Selling, general and administrative expenses decreased 13.8% year over year to $997 million. Research and development expenses totaled $448 million, reflecting a year-over-year rise of 16.4%.
GE Aerospace’s operating profit (non-GAAP) was $2.3 billion, up 14% year over year. The margin was 19.2%, contracting 90 basis points (bps) year over year.
GE Aerospace’s Balance Sheet & Cash Flow
Exiting the fourth quarter of 2025, GE Aerospace had cash, cash equivalents and restricted cash of $12.4 billion compared with $13.6 billion at the end of December 2024. The company’s long-term borrowings were $18.8 billion compared with $17.2 billion at the end of December 2024.
In the fourth quarter, the adjusted free cash flow was $1.76 billion compared with $1.53 billion in the year-ago quarter.
GE’s Outlook
For 2026, GE expects adjusted revenues to grow in the low-double-digit range from the year-ago period's actual. Operating profit is estimated to be in the band of $9.85-$10.25 billion. Adjusted earnings are predicted to be in the range of $7.10-$7.40 per share. The free cash flow is anticipated to be in the band of $8.0-$8.4 billion, with the conversion rate projected to be more than 100%.
GE Aerospace expects the Commercial Engines & Services segment’s revenues to grow in the mid-teens range, whereas operating profit is anticipated to be in the band of $9.60-$9.90 billion. For the Defense & Propulsion Technologies segment, revenues are projected to increase in the mid-to-high single-digit range, whereas operating profit is anticipated to be in the band of $1.55-$1.65 billion.
